This track explores the foundational principles of contract law as they apply to the sports industry. It aims to provide insights into the legal frameworks governing athlete contracts and management agreements.

This session focuses on effective negotiation techniques for athlete representation and management agreements. Participants will analyze case studies to understand the dynamics of successful negotiations in sports.

This track examines the various forms of legal liability that can arise from sports contracts. It will address issues related to breach of contract, negligence, and the implications for athletes and organizations.

This session delves into the intersection of employment law and labor rights within the sports sector. Discussions will cover athlete rights, collective bargaining, and the role of unions in sports.

This track highlights the importance of compliance and governance in sports management. It will explore regulatory frameworks and best practices for ensuring ethical conduct in sports organizations.

This session investigates the legal aspects of sponsorship agreements in sports. It will cover contract negotiation, rights and obligations, and the impact of sponsorship on athlete management.

This track focuses on arbitration and alternative dispute resolution mechanisms in the sports context. Participants will explore the effectiveness of these methods in resolving conflicts between athletes and organizations.

This session addresses the critical role of risk management in athlete representation and contract negotiation. It will provide strategies for mitigating legal risks and ensuring athlete protection.

This track reviews significant legal precedents that have influenced the development of sports law. Participants will analyze landmark cases and their implications for current practices in athlete management.

This session examines the responsibilities of sports administration in upholding contract law. Discussions will focus on governance structures and their impact on athlete management agreements.

This track explores the latest trends and innovations in sports contracts, including digital agreements and performance-based clauses. Participants will discuss how these trends are reshaping athlete management and legal practices.
